#22959f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#22959f is composed of 13.3% red, 58.4%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.6% cyan, 6.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 184.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 37.8%. #22959f color hex could be obtained by blending #44ffff with #002b3f.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#22959f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#22959f has RGB values of R:34, G:149,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 2266527.

Shades and Tints of #22959f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d0e is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#22959f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6364 is the less saturated color, while #04aebd is the most saturated one.
